JAY-Z sells 50 percent stake of Ace of Spades to LVMH

The hip hop mogul said the partnership will take his champagne brand to “the next level of taste and distribution.”

JAY-Z has entered a partnership with LVMH. On Monday (Feb. 22), Moët Hennessy, the luxury conglomerate’s wine and spirits division, announced its purchase of a 50 percent stake in JAY-Z’s champagne brand Armand de Brignac, commonly known as Ace of Spades.

Appearing on CNBC’s “Squawk Box” on Monday to announce the deal, Hov said he and LVMH began discussing the potential partnership in 2019.

“It just started out in a place of respect and built from there pretty quickly,” he said on the show.

According to Yahoo! Finance, JAY also called Moët a “natural partner” and said the deal would take Armand de Brignac to “the next level of taste and distribution.”
